Chicken Alfredo Calzone Recipe

What is a Calzone?

A calzone is a delicious Italian dish that resembles a folded pizza. It’s made from pizza dough, filled with various ingredients, and then baked until golden brown. The name “calzone” means “trouser” in Italian, which reflects its shape. Traditionally, calzones are stuffed with cheese, meats, and vegetables, making them a versatile meal option. They are perfect for lunch, dinner, or even a snack. The best part? You can customize them to suit your taste!

Ingredients for Chicken Alfredo Calzone Recipe

Essential Ingredients

To create a mouthwatering Chicken Alfredo Calzone, you’ll need a few key ingredients. These essentials ensure that your calzone is flavorful and satisfying.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
  • 1 cup Alfredo sauce
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 package (13.8 ounces) refrigerated pizza dough
  • 1 egg, beaten (for egg wash)
  • Olive oil, for brushing

These ingredients come together to create a delicious filling that is creamy, cheesy, and packed with flavor. The combination of chicken and Alfredo sauce makes for a hearty meal that everyone will love.

Step-by-Step Preparation of Chicken Alfredo Calzone Recipe

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

First, you need to prepare the chicken. If you have leftover cooked chicken, that’s perfect! Simply shred it into bite-sized pieces. If you’re starting with raw chicken, cook it in a skillet over medium heat until it’s no longer pink. This usually takes about 10-15 minutes. Once cooked, let it cool slightly before shredding. This step is crucial because tender chicken makes your calzone even more delicious!

Step 2: Make the Alfredo Sauce

Next, let’s make the Alfredo sauce. If you’re using store-bought sauce, you can skip this step. However, making your own is easy and adds a personal touch. In a saucepan, melt 1/2 cup of butter over medium heat. Add 1 cup of heavy cream and stir until combined. Then, mix in 1 cup of grated Parmesan cheese, 2 cloves of minced garlic,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Stir until the cheese melts and the sauce thickens. This creamy sauce will be the star of your calzone!

Step 3: Prepare the Dough

Now it’s time to prepare the dough. Take your package of refrigerated pizza dough and roll it out on a lightly floured surface. Aim for a large rectangle, about 1/4 inch thick. If the dough is too sticky, sprinkle a little more flour. This step is important because a well-rolled dough ensures a perfect calzone shape. Once rolled out, cut the dough into four equal squares. Each square will hold a generous amount of filling!

Step 4: Assemble the Calzone

Assembling your calzone is where the fun begins! Take one square of dough and spoon a generous amount of the chicken and Alfredo mixture onto one half. Be sure to leave a small border around the edges. This will help seal the calzone. Next, fold the other half of the dough over the filling to create a pocket. Press the edges together firmly to seal. For extra security, use a fork to crimp the edges. This step keeps all that delicious filling inside!

Step 5: Bake the Calzone

Finally, it’s time to bake your calzones! Place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Brush the tops with the beaten egg for a golden finish. Don’t forget to poke a few holes in the top of each calzone to let steam escape. Bake in your preheated oven at 425°F (220°C) for 15-20 minutes, or until they are golden brown. The aroma will fill your kitchen, making it hard to wait!

Tips for Making the Best Chicken Alfredo Calzone Recipe

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making a Chicken Alfredo Calzone can be a fun and rewarding experience. However, there are some common mistakes that can affect the final result. Here are a few pitfalls to watch out for:

  • Using Cold Dough: Always let your pizza dough come to room temperature before rolling it out. Cold dough can be tough to work with and may not roll out evenly.
  • Not Sealing Properly: Ensure you seal the edges of your calzone well. If they’re not sealed properly, the filling can leak out during baking, making a mess.
  • Overbaking: Keep an eye on your calzones as they bake. Overbaking can lead to a dry filling and tough crust. Aim for a golden brown color.
  • Skipping the Egg Wash: Brushing the tops with egg wash not only gives a beautiful finish but also helps the calzones brown nicely. Don’t skip this step!
  • Ignoring the Steam Holes: Poking holes in the top of each calzone is essential. This allows steam to escape, preventing sogginess and ensuring a crispy crust.

By avoiding these common mistakes, you’ll be on your way to creating the perfect Chicken Alfredo Calzone that everyone will love!

Storage Tips for Leftovers

If you have leftover Chicken Alfredo Calzones, you can store them for later enjoyment. Here are some helpful storage tips:

  • Cool Completely: Before storing, let the calzones cool completely at room temperature. This prevents condensation, which can make them soggy.
  • Use Airtight Containers: Place the calzones in airtight containers or wrap them tightly in plastic wrap. This helps keep them fresh and prevents them from drying out.
  • Refrigerate: Store the calzones in the refrigerator if you plan to eat them within a few days. They can last up to 3-4 days in the fridge.
  • Freeze for Longer Storage: If you want to keep them longer, consider freezing the calzones. Wrap each one in foil or plastic wrap, then place them in a freezer-safe bag. They can last up to 2-3 months in the freezer.
  • Reheat Properly: When you’re ready to enjoy your leftovers, reheat them in the oven for the best results.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 10-15 minutes until heated through.

By following these storage tips, you can enjoy your Chicken Alfredo Calzones even after the initial meal. They make for a quick and tasty snack or meal option!

FAQs about Chicken Alfredo Calzone Recipe

Can I use store-bought dough for the Chicken Alfredo Calzone Recipe?

Absolutely! Using store-bought dough is a great time-saver. Many grocery stores offer refrigerated pizza dough that is ready to use. This option is perfect for those who want to skip the dough-making process. Just roll it out as directed in the recipe, and you’re good to go! Store-bought dough can still yield delicious calzones, so don’t hesitate to use it if you’re short on time.

How can I make the Chicken Alfredo Calzone Recipe healthier?

Making your Chicken Alfredo Calzone healthier is easier than you might think! Here are some simple tips:

  • Use Whole Wheat Dough: Opt for whole wheat pizza dough instead of regular dough. This adds more fiber and nutrients.
  • Lean Chicken: Choose skinless chicken breast for a leaner protein option. This reduces the overall fat content.
  • Light Alfredo Sauce: Look for a light or reduced-fat Alfredo sauce. You can also make a homemade version using low-fat ingredients.
  • Add Vegetables: Incorporate more vegetables into the filling, such as spinach, bell peppers, or zucchini. This boosts the nutritional value and adds flavor.
  • Limit Cheese: Use less cheese or choose lower-fat cheese options. This can help cut down on calories and fat.

By making these small adjustments, you can enjoy a healthier version of your Chicken Alfredo Calzone without sacrificing taste!
